Business & IndustryTM (B&I) database contains information with facts, figures, and key events dealing with public and private companies, industries, markets products for all manufacturing and service industries at an international level. B&I coverage concentrates on leading trade magazines and newsletters, the general business press, regional newspapers and international business dailies. The database includes abstracts and fulltext of relevant articles, and is enhanced with rich indexing that enables highly specific retrieval of relevant articles.
USE FILE 9to find complete-text articles focusing on industries, manufacturing, and services. USE IN=to focus on any specific industry. EXPAND IN= for a complete list of industries. USE CT=to specify a particular concept, e.g., MARKET SHARE. EXPAND CT= to see a complete list of Concept Terms. /p> |
Business & IndustryTM is used when searching for information on companies, industries, markets and products. The type of information that can be specifically retrieved include:
market size, market share, shipments, users, test marketing, company and industry forecasts, trends, demographics, company strategy, joint ventures, mergers and acquisitions, privatization, foreign investment, capacity, product development, introductions, and recalls and information dealing with markets, such as the African-American market, Green market, Asian-American market, youth market, and baby boomers.
All major industries are covered in B&I including advertising, aerospace and defense, agriculture, apparel, automotive, biotechnology, chemical, computers and software, electronics, energy, fast foods, financial services, food and beverages, furniture, health care services, information, insurance, mining, oil and gas, plastics, pulp and paper, retailing, telecommunications, and transportation.

1 The Extract field (/XT) searches both the Abstract and Lead Paragraph fields.
2 Effective from July 2000 forward, abstracts are no longer produced for records having the complete text of the article; use /LP to search the first paragraphs of text.
3 Searchable in the Basic Index and in the Additional Indexes.
4 /DE includes Concept Terms, Marketing Terms, and Industry Names.
5 Slogan will cease indexing as of March 2002, but backfile data will remain online.
6 Spokesperson and Named Character will cease indexing as of March 2002, but backfile will remain online.
